Varroa Jacobsonioud Affecting Honey Bees by R. Cavalloro Pdf

Beekeeping within the ec is threatened by a disastrous mite pest. Since 1977 when varroa jacobsoni entered the federal repiblic of Germany it has already invaled greece, Italy and France. within a few years the entire mainland of the EC will tis problem. Because it is difficult to demostrate the initial infestation of a honeybee colony with varroa, it is almost impossible to obtain a reliable survey of the distribution of this mite. Many more countries may be infested at this moment. Therefore control measures have to be taken even before Varroa mites are found. The death of honeybee colonies follows within 3-4 years after infestation. This stage has been in the federal republic of Germany and Greece.

Splits and Varroa by William Hesbach Pdf

Widespread use of toxic chemical controls to Varroa in the early years proved both environmentally hazardous and easily resisted by the mite. Consequently, various management control styles have emerged - some of which have over time also proved very damaging to the colony. This booklet is for the Beekeeper looking for less toxic and more natural alternatives without the use of chemicals and advises that successful Varroa control can be achieved by manipulations using splits and based on knowledge of the mites life cycle.
